摘要: 20世纪初,I.W.Bailey和E.W.Sinnot首先提出被子植物叶片的一些特征,尤其是全缘叶种类百分比和年平均气温之间的相关关系非常密切。70年代末,J.A. Wolfe定量研究了全缘叶种类百分比和年平均气温之间的线性关系。90年代以来,叶相分析进入多变量分析阶段,J.A.Wolfe提出“气候与叶片多变量分析程序”(Climate-keaf Analysis Multivariate Program CLAMP)。运用CLAMP程序在定量重建古气候、古纬度、古海拔等方面已取得一些重要研究进展。最后,本文对有关问题进行了讨论。

Abstract: At the begianing of the 20 th century, I.W.Bailey and E.W.Sinnot proposed a novel idea Of the close correlation Of physiognomic characteristics,particularly percentage Of entire species with mean annual temperature.In the late 1970s Jack A.Wolfe investigated the linear correlation of percentage of entire species and mean annual temperature.In 1990s Jack A.Wolfe developed Climate-Leaf Analysis Multivariate Program(CLAMP) which is characteristic of accuracy and precision peftainjng to the estimates of palaeoclimate,palaeoelevation,etc.Relevant problems are discussed and future directions are prospected.
